The Opportunity:
The purpose of this role is to carry out manufacturing activities to GMP standards within the Scientific Preparation Facility using the OneLab electronic laboratory notebook.
The Research Technician ensures their knowledge of methods used in the Macclesfield laboratories is fully utilized to improve products and processes, exceeding customer expectations.
The technician liaises with customers for new product requests, suggesting improvements to formulations or methods based on their technical understanding.
They also have a good understanding of the products used on the site (both analyst-prepared and externally purchased) and can proactively offer comparable in-house alternatives.
The role involves seeking sustainability improvements and cost-effective service enhancements while maintaining high-quality standards.
The Research Technician typically has multiple years of laboratory experience and a strong understanding of products used on the site, supporting the preparation of medias, buffers, and solutions to meet user requirements and standards. Responsibilities include manufacturing, operational activities, customer liaison, and compliance with standards and SLAs.
